What is VTV?
VTV is a video blog where you will find short interviews with industry experts on the most important issues in online marketing, e-commerce, sales and distribution in the hotel industry. Each week, host John McAuliffe, Chief Marketing Officer of VFM Leonardo interviews an industry expert on a single topic related to online merchandising in order to help you extract more value from your hotel's presence on the Internet.

About VFM Leonardo
VFM Leonardo is a technology leader in online visual content management and distribution systems. VFM Leonardo's VScape(R) and VBrochure(TM) products leverage the distribution capabilities of the VNetwork(TM), the most universally accepted and largest online visual content distribution network for the global travel industry including all four global distribution systems (GDSs), Pegasus and travel-related channels including online travel agencies, travel research and supplier web sites, search portals and major travel intermediaries. VFM Leonardo offers the hotel industry the most effective digital asset management and online merchandising systems available today and efficiently delivers over 1,000,000 visual images (photos, virtual tours and videos) to more than 30,000 travel channels and websites in the VNetwork including Amadeus, Galileo, Sabre, Worldspan, Pegasus, Travelocity, Orbitz, Priceline, Tripadvisor, Yahoo!
